Que diferencia hay entre una catedral y una iglesia??

Respuesta :

isabelquintana
isabelquintana isabelquintana
  • 04-12-2021

Answer:

Una catedral es un templo cristiano, donde tiene su sede o cátedra el obispo de la diócesis, por tanto, es la iglesia principal o mayor de cada diócesis o iglesia particular.
